Portable Pump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ak (less than 1 gallon per minute) Yes No Small leaks can often be fixed with a DIY repair kit.
Large leak (over 1 gallon per minute) No Yes Larger leaks need specialized equipment and expertise to fix safely and effectively.
Water damage in a confined space (e.g. Attic, crawl space) No Yes Confined spaces need specialized equipment and expertise to fix safely and effectively.
Water damage in a large area (e.g. Entire basement) No Yes Larger areas need specialized equipment and expertise to fix safely and effectively.
You’re not sure what to do No Yes If you’re unsure about how to fix a water leak or water damage, it’s always best to call a professional.

Portable Pump Water Extraction Cost In Lexington, OK

The cost of portable pump water extraction in Lexington, OK will v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and other local factors.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ment. We’ll work with you to find out the best course of action and provide you with a clear estimate of the costs involved.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and pumping $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
Moisture reading and assessment $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Drying and d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
Containment and cleanup $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Final inspection and certification $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
